I like the idea of using BCAAs or EAAs right when you wake up and before cardio, because it's not gonna negatively affect your ability to burn cals/fat. I'd mix up either that kind of thing or simply a 20g whey protein drink with a little gatorade or something (or 2-6oz of juice+water, a little milk+water, or I guess you could just go with the aminos alone if you wanna avoid carbs altogether. It's just better for absorbtion with something else).

The small amount of cals we're talking about will be negligible and burn up immediately during your workout. They will, however (IMO) be very valuable for preservation of muscle tissue when you're cutting, especially if you're using clen. Not that clen is evil, because I'm a big clen fan for a cut. Big fan. I just find that when you use that kind of thing, cut cals, and up the cardio, it's easy to go into a catabolic state if you aren't infusing your body with enough amino acids (or protein in general).

I'd make sure to take 1-2T of flax oil daily on a cut too. Another really good option is carb cycling, but that's another discussion altogether. Good luck, and keep us posted on how things roll...
